Deonna Purrazzo has been one of the top-tier women’s talent produced by the wrestling industry. The Virtuosa had her early beginnings in Ring of Honor, however, did not have a positive opinion in regards to Women’s wrestling contributing to the promotion’s success.

During a recent interview on  Talk Is Jericho, Purrazzo stated that women were very much held back during her time in Ring of Honor and believed that they deserved much better.

“No. I think, for many different reason, we were very held back. I think there were people in higher positions that didn’t believe in women’s wrestling. I couldn’t tell you the emails I sent to Joe Koff and I would get the statistics from YouTube pages and Instagram numbers and be like, ‘look at the interaction we’re getting. Look at the numbers we’re bringing to the company. We deserve better.’ I don’t feel it ever happened.”

The former IMPACT Knockouts champion further opened up on whether that scenario persuaded her to leave the promotion in 2018.

“Yeah, at the same time, mid-2018 WWE had approached me about having me in the Mae Young Classic, having them sign me, but I was in the middle of my Ring of Honor contract. I did have an opt out clause, so six months in, I could say, ‘this isn’t for me, I want to leave,’ and that’s exactly what I did. I felt like my hands were tied, but I’m trying so hard, I’m fighting for women to get this opportunity, and it’s not happening, and I don’t know what else I can do personally, professionally, and more I could give of myself to make it happen, so maybe it’s time to move on.”

Despite her exit in 2018, Deonna Purrazzo earned ROH gold in 2022. She competed against Roxanne Perez and won the ROH Women’s Title on the January 13, 2022 episode of IMPACT Wrestling.

Furthermore, she once again finds herself close to Ring of Honor. The Virtuosa made her official debut for All Elite Wrestling on the first Dynamite of 2024, with Ring of Honor being the sister promotion of Tony Khan’s company.
